Hi David. I'm brand new to the harmonica (3 weeks in) and have really enjoyed the direction that this site has given. There's a ton of information and it would probably be an overload without the systematic approach of LOA. I'm sure you have this info somewhere but I couldn't find it. I have been able to practice most days 30-60 minutes. I can play single notes up and down, most of Walk With Me & Solo Study 1. My question is how would you structure 30-60 min of practice time per day? What are the most important things to be focusing on? Also, I looked ahead and saw a Bending Study 2 but couldn't find # 1. Welcome to the site Snrubnivek, I'm glad you're enjoying your studies. Students should generally focus their practice time as follows…

10m = Technique - Work on something hard… something you can't do well at all.

30m = Study Song - This is "Walk with Me" for you right now. As you're buttoning up "Walk with Me" you can start working on Tongue Block Study 2 at the same time. Most of your studies on the site are in the form of study song (mostly tongue blocking and bending for you in the first two years)

20m = Solo Harmonica Study, Music Theory and other areas of interest. Down the road you'll use this 20m for improvising.

Bending Study 1 you'll find on the Lessons page and does not contain a study song, this is why it's not listen in LOA, but you'll no doubt need to start with it, it's where you learn how to bend.
